New Ticket     Tickets     Wiki     Browse Source     Timeline     Roadmap     Ticket Reports     Search

Ticket #26638 (closed defect: invalid)

Opened 3 years ago

Last modified 3 years ago

emacs and emacs-app fail to build on Snow Leopard

Reported by: migmit@… Owned by: dports@…
Priority: Normal Milestone:
Component: ports Version: 1.9.1
Keywords: Cc: css@…
Port: emacs, emacs-app

Description

Seems like a bootstrap-emacs crashes with a segmentation fault in both cases. Debug output attached.

Attachments

emacs.txt (130.9 KB) - added by migmit@… 3 years ago.
emacs-app.txt (78.9 KB) - added by migmit@… 3 years ago.

Change History

Changed 3 years ago by migmit@…

Changed 3 years ago by migmit@…

comment:1 Changed 3 years ago by jmr@…

  • Owner changed from macports-tickets@… to dports@…
  • Cc css@… added

Please remember to cc the maintainers.

comment:2 Changed 3 years ago by dports@…

It works for me. Are you by any chance using a non-standard compiler or any non-standard options?

comment:3 Changed 3 years ago by migmit@…

Don't think so. Never installed any compilers except those from macports and XCode.

comment:4 Changed 3 years ago by css@…

Have you applied all XCode and OS updates?

comment:5 Changed 3 years ago by migmit@…

Well, there was one Security Update pending; but I've installed it today, tried rebuilding emacs and got the same error.

comment:6 Changed 3 years ago by migmit@…

Tried uninstalling everything and installing emacs. No good, same error.

comment:7 Changed 3 years ago by css@…

I just built and installed emacs-app without any trouble. Do you have anything in /usr/local?

comment:8 Changed 3 years ago by migmit@…

Yes, thanks, that was the problem. I've uninstalled everything, renamed /usr/local to local.bak and installed emacs without trouble. After that I've tried to install emacs-app, and failed with a segmentation fault again. On a hunch, I've uninstalled emacs, and the emacs-app installation went smoothly, and I was able to install emacs after it. Everything seems to be working now.

comment:9 Changed 3 years ago by css@…

  • Status changed from new to closed
  • Resolution set to invalid

I don't think I've ever tried installing both emacs and emacs-app, but it sounds like something from /usr/local got in the way. We might need to consider the ports as conflicting, recommending users to install only one.

comment:10 Changed 3 years ago by dports@…

They don't conflict -- I have them both installed.

comment:11 Changed 3 years ago by migmit@…

Well, me too, that's not the point. The point is, they do conflict if you install emacs first.

Note: See TracTickets for help on using tickets.